Looks like Ben Affleck won’t be starting a new relationship anytime soon

After breaking up with Ana de Armas, Ben Affleck will not soon risk entering into a new relationship. At least, so believes an insider from the actor’s inner circle.

“Ben admits that he’ll be better off alone for a while unless a miracle happens and Ana comes back to him asking him to give her another chance,” the insider shares. — He’s really focused on prioritizing himself and his kids over relationships with women. He even jokingly gave his friends a vow of celibacy. Friends tell Ben that he needs to work on himself instead of throwing himself into relationships, which become complicated and stressful once the candy-coating period ends.”

Recall that Affleck, 48, and De Armas, 32, have been together for about a year. Actors met on the set of Adrian Lyne’s new film “Deep Water”, which will be released in the summer of 2021. Rumor has it that the reason for the separation were different views on the life of the now ex-beloved. The breakup of the couple took place over the phone, and the initiator of the breakup was Ana: “Ana — a young, adventurous by nature. In her free time she wants to travel and Ben has to stay in Los Angeles because of the children.

Recall that from his marriage to Jennifer Garner, Affleck has three children: 14-year-old Violet, 11-year-old Serafina, and eight-year-old Samuel. Judging by the paparazzi photos, Ana got along great with Ben’s kids. The actress seems to have managed to find common ground with Ben’s younger brother Casey Affleck as well. “I think Ana is a godsend in every way,” believes the actor. — “I’ll be there for Ben to help him through this period, but I don’t think he’ll have a hard time.

We hope Casey turns out to be right. Lately, Ben has been looking depressed and losing a lot of weight. That Affleck is going through a bad time was confirmed by an insider close to the actor, “He’s very upset that he and Ana broke up. Ben wanted things to work out for them.”
